Well I recently installed Windows onto a second partition but I have now decided I would like that partition back as free space. I don't have my Windows cd anymore so booting up with that and reformatting isn't an option.

Is there anyway I can force a format of the partition without reformatting my whole drive?

I tried to go through Disk Utility but windows has disabled all the permissions so it is considered non-writable.

I also tried to force a reformat by installing OS X onto the partition, but it returned a failed install.

I'm running a Macbook Pro Intel Core Duo and I have the OS X Tiger 10.4 Install disc

You could have just ran the Boot Camp Assistant and told it to revert the system back to its original settings. And before you say you wouldn't be able to because Boot Camp had expired on your system, simply changing the date back to a time before it expired would have gotten the job done.
